Cook.ai is an AI-run marketing workspace operated by ClientAcquisition.io(“Cook”, “we”). This policy explains what personal data we handle, why, and the choices you have. Questions and requests: systems@clientacquisition.io.

The two roles we play

For your account and your use of Cook, we decide how data is handled — we are the data controller. For the business records your workspace holds (your clients, your leads, form submissions on your funnel pages), you are the controller and Cook processes that data on your instructions as a processor.

What we collect

  • Account data: name, email address, password (stored hashed), and sign-in identifiers from Slack or Discord if you use social sign-in.
  • Workspace content: chats with your AI departments, files you upload, documents, and generated media.
  • CRM records you or your integrations add: client and lead names, email addresses, phone numbers, notes, and pipeline status.
  • Funnel form submissions from your pages: the fields a visitor types, plus a consent record (what they agreed to, when, from which page).
  • Billing data: subscription and credit usage. Card details go directly to Stripe and never touch our servers.
  • Connected integration credentials, stored encrypted (AES-GCM).
  • Usage data: page analytics without cookies, and server logs for security and debugging.

Why we use it

  • To run the service you signed up for — your account, workspace, and AI agents (performance of a contract).
  • To bill you (performance of a contract, legal obligations).
  • To keep the service secure and debug problems (legitimate interest).
  • To measure product usage with cookieless analytics (legitimate interest).
  • To send marketing on behalf of our customers to their contacts — done on the customer's instructions; the customer is responsible for having a lawful basis.

AI processing

Cook does its work by sending workspace content to AI model providers (Anthropic, OpenAI, Google) and media generators. These providers process the content to produce the requested output. We do not use your content to train models of our own.

Who we share data with

We use the following service providers (subprocessors) to run Cook:

ProviderWhat it does
ConvexDatabase and application backend
VercelWeb and funnel-page hosting, cookieless page analytics
RailwayAI service hosting
CloudflareFile storage (R2) and course video streaming (Stream)
StripePayment processing
AutumnBilling and credit metering
ResendTransactional email delivery
OneSignalPush notifications
AnthropicAI text generation
OpenAIAI text generation
GoogleAI (Gemini) and Calendar sync
CohereSearch embeddings for course content
ElevenLabsAudio transcription
LiveKitReal-time voice sessions
MetaAd delivery and conversion measurement for customer campaigns
fal / KieAI image and video generation
Blaxel / E2BSandboxed compute for agent jobs
Freestyle / GitHubFunnel code repositories and previews
GoHighLevel / CloseCRM sync, when a customer connects one
FathomMeeting recording sync, when a customer connects it
Slack / Discord / Telegram / WhopMessaging bridges, when connected

We do not sell personal data. Beyond these providers, we disclose data only when the law requires it or to protect the service from abuse.

International transfers

Our providers process data primarily in the United States. Where data about people in the EU, EEA, or UK is transferred, we rely on the providers’ data processing agreements and standard contractual clauses.

How long we keep data

  • Account and workspace data: for as long as your account exists.
  • Backups: rolling snapshots kept for 14 days.
  • Billing records: as long as tax and accounting law requires.
  • Deleted data: removed from the live database at deletion time and from backups as they expire.

Your rights

You can access, correct, export, or delete your data. In the app: Settings lets you export your workspace’s data and delete your account or organization. By email: send requests to systems@clientacquisition.io and we will respond within 30 days. If you are in the EU, EEA, or UK, you also have the rights to restrict or object to processing and to complain to your supervisory authority. In Canada, you may complain to the Office of the Privacy Commissioner of Canada or, in Quebec, to the Commission d’accès à l’information du Québec. If your data is in a customer’s workspace (for example, you are their client or a lead), contact that business — they control it — and we will help them honor your request.

Cookies

The Cook app itself sets only cookies the service needs to work: your sign-in session, your theme, and your active workspace. Our page analytics does not use cookies. Funnel pages our customers publish are the customers’ own websites and may use advertising cookies with the visitor’s consent where consent is required — each funnel carries its own privacy policy.

Children

Cook is a business tool and is not directed at children under 16. We do not knowingly collect their data.
